Photoshop高级蒙版技术:掌握关键图像合成的艺术
发布时间: 2024-12-14 15:06:28 阅读量: 4 订阅数: 15
photoshop设计师圣经高级蒙版与图像合成技法
![PS 基础教程与安装方式](https://img.zcool.cn/community/0180cc5e560ad0a801216518da6b06.jpg?x-oss-process=image/auto-orient,1/resize,m_lfit,w_1280,limit_1/sharpen,100/quality,q_100)
参考资源链接:[Photoshop基础教程:安装与入门指南](https://wenku.csdn.net/doc/3w2z8ezuz8?spm=1055.2635.3001.10343)
# 1. Photoshop蒙版技术概述
## 1.1 什么是蒙版及其重要性
蒙版是Photoshop中一种非常强大的图像编辑工具,它允许用户对图片中的特定区域进行非破坏性的调整。蒙版的主要作用是遮盖,其理念是在不改变原始图像数据的情况下,决定图像哪些部分可见,哪些部分被隐藏。蒙版的重要性在于其提供了一种非常灵活的方式来对图片进行精确编辑,便于后期的修改和优化。
## 1.2 蒙版的种类:快速蒙版、图层蒙版和矢量蒙版
Photoshop提供了几种不同类型的蒙版,每一种都适用于特定的编辑需求。快速蒙版是一种临时蒙版,它允许快速选择图像的一部分,然后转换成选区或者常规蒙版。图层蒙版可以与图层联合使用,允许用户以非破坏性的方式调整图像的可见区域,而不影响原图。矢量蒙版则主要用于处理插画或者图形设计中的文字和形状,因为它们与分辨率无关,适合进行缩放操作而不失真。
## 1.3 蒙版技术的应用场景
蒙版技术广泛应用于摄影后期处理、插画创作和UI设计等场景。例如,在合并多个不同曝光的照片时,可以使用蒙版选择性地结合这些照片的不同部分,以达到最佳的视觉效果。在设计工作中,蒙版能够帮助设计师隔离出特定图层的边缘,创造出独特的视觉层次感。此外,在进行颜色校正时,蒙版也能够限制校正效果仅作用于特定区域,使调整更精确、有效。这些应用都体现了蒙版技术的灵活性和实用性,使其成为了数字图像编辑不可或缺的一部分。
【注】:此内容为模拟生成的章节内容,实际操作中蒙版的使用和优化涉及更复杂的操作和技巧,需要结合具体的Photoshop功能和图像处理需求进行详细说明。
# 2. Photoshop蒙版的理论基础
## 2.1 蒙版的基本概念和类型
### 2.1.1 什么是蒙版及其重要性
在Photoshop的世界里,蒙版是一个关键工具,它允许用户进行非破坏性编辑,即在不永久更改原始图像的情况下进行编辑。蒙版可以看作是一张覆盖在图层上的“遮罩”,它定义了哪些部分的图层是可见的,哪些是被隐藏的。蒙版中的黑色部分隐藏了图层,而白色部分则使图层内容可见。
蒙版的重要性在于它的灵活性和可逆性。一旦创建,你可以随时修改蒙版而不影响原始图像数据,这大大提高了编辑的自由度和精确性。它让图像编辑者可以更加精确地控制图像的哪些部分需要编辑,哪些部分保持不变。
### 2.1.2 蒙版的种类:快速蒙版、图层蒙版和矢量蒙版
Photoshop提供了多种蒙版类型,包括快速蒙版、图层蒙版和矢量蒙版,每种都有其特定用途。
- **快速蒙版**:快速蒙版是一种临时性的蒙版,允许你通过涂画来建立选区。它不是基于黑白遮罩原理,而是通过颜色的半透明度来表示选区范围。快速蒙版模式通常在你按“Q”键时启用,可以快速创建一个临时的红色覆盖层。
- **图层蒙版**:图层蒙版与特定图层关联,是最常用的蒙版类型。它通过黑白遮罩来控制图层的可见性。你可以使用画笔工具在蒙版上添加黑色或白色来隐藏或显示图层的部分内容。
- **矢量蒙版**:矢量蒙版是基于矢量图形的蒙版,它允许进行无损的可编辑矢量形状的蒙版。矢量蒙版与路径相关,因此它可以被缩放和变形而不会损失质量。
## 2.2 蒙版与选区的关系
### 2.2.1 选区的创建和修改
在Photoshop中,创建蒙版前通常需要创建一个选区。选区是图像上你想要进行编辑的部分。创建选区的常用工具包括套索工具、魔棒工具和快速选择工具。选区可以通过增加、减去或交叉的方式来修改,以达到精确选择的目的。
- **增加选区**:按住Shift键,可以添加更多的区域到当前选区。
- **减去选区**:按住Alt键(或Option键,Mac用户),可以从当前选区中减去已选的部分。
- **交叉选区**:按住Shift+Alt键(或Shift+Option键),将仅保留两个选区的交集部分。
### 2.2.2 如何将选区转换成蒙版
将选区转换成蒙版是一个简单的过程:
1. 创建并调整好选区后,选择“图层”菜单下的“新建图层蒙版”,这时选区会转换成图层蒙版。
2. 选区将转换为白色(显示)和黑色(隐藏)遮罩。
3. 你还可以通过点击图层面板底部的添加图层蒙版按钮(一个圆圈里面有个方框的图标),然后在图像上绘制来创建蒙版。
一旦选区转换成蒙版,你就可以使用画笔工具以黑色或白色进一步细化蒙版边缘。
## 2.3 蒙版在图像处理中的作用
### 2.3.1 遮盖和显示图像的特定部分
蒙版最直接的用途之一就是遮盖图像的某些部分,使其他部分可见。例如,在处理人像时,你可能只想调整背景的亮度或颜色,而不影响人物。通过创建一个包含人物的选区并将其转换为蒙版,就可以在图层面板上隐藏背景,然后对背景层进行编辑。
### 2.3.2 保持非破坏性编辑的实践
非破坏性编辑是通过使用蒙版、智能对象和其他Photoshop功能来避免直接修改原始图像数据的过程。蒙版是实现非破坏性编辑的关键,因为它们允许你永久保存编辑指令,而不是直接修改像素。
使用蒙版,你可以:
- 在任何时候自由地调整编辑,例如改变蒙版中黑色和白色的分布。
- 恢复到原始图像的任何阶段,因为所有的编辑都是通过蒙版来控制。
- 对多个图层应用统一的蒙版,以保持整体的一致性。
这样,你可以确保原始图像保持不变,而所有编辑都是可逆的,这在需要修改或尝试不同编辑方法时非常有用。
# 3. 高级蒙版技术的实践应用
## 3.1 精细蒙版的创建技巧
在高级图像处理中,蒙版技术的运用直接影响到图像的最终效果。蒙版提供了针对图像特定区域进行编辑的能力,它是一种非破坏性的编辑方式。如何创建一个精细的蒙版,是对Photoshop操作者技术水平的一个重要考验。
### 3.1.1 使用选择和遮罩工具精炼蒙版边缘
要创建一个精细的蒙版,第一步是通过选择工具来确定图像中的目标区域。Photoshop提供了多种选择工具,如快速选择工具、魔棒工具和套索工具等。选择工具能够基于颜色、亮度或其他属性快速创建选区。接下来,使用蒙版工具来细化这些选区的边缘。
具体操作步骤如下:
1. 使用快速选择工具或套索工具选择大致区域。
2. 在选区边缘使用“调整边缘”功能,增强选区的精确度。
3. 可以手动调整边缘平滑度、对比度和移动边缘以获得更精确的选区。
4. 应用蒙版,并在图层面板中查看蒙版效果。
代码块展示如何使用Python配合PIL库来实现边缘的平滑度调整,代码逻辑分析如下:
```python
from PIL import Image, ImageFilter
# 加载图片并转化为灰度图
img = Image.open('path_to_image').convert('L')
# 使用高斯模糊处理边缘
blurred_edge = img.filter(ImageFilter.GaussianBlur(radius=2))
# 根据模糊后的图片与原图差值获取边缘信息
edge = ImageChops.difference(img, blurred_edge)
# 扩展边缘,可以理解为边缘平滑
edge = edge.point(lambda p: p * 1.1).expand(2)
# 将边缘信息转换为蒙版
mask = Image.new('L', img.size, 255)
mask.paste(edge, mask=mask)
# 显示蒙版
mask.show()
```
在上述代码中,我们首先加载一张图片并将其转化为灰度图,接着使用高斯模糊来平滑图像边缘,然后通过与原图的差异计算出边缘信息,并通过扩展边缘来实现平滑效果。最后,将边缘信息转换为蒙版。
### 3.1.2 利用调整边缘和蒙版羽化优化图像
羽化功能是蒙版边缘优化的重要工具。羽化可以使选区的边缘变得模糊,从而使蒙版与周围像素的过渡更自然。在Photoshop中,可以通过“调整边缘”对话框中的“羽化”滑块来设置羽化值。
羽化应用的参数说明:
- **羽化半径**:决定边缘模糊的范围大小。
- **平滑度**:影响蒙版边缘的连续性和平滑性。
- **羽化算法**:不同的算法可以对蒙版边缘产生不同的影响。
代码逻辑扩展说明:
```python
import cv2
import numpy as np
# 加载图片并创建一个空白蒙版
image = cv2.imread('path_to_image')
mask = np.zeros(image.shape[:2], dtype="uint8")
# 根据某些标准创建一个初步的掩码
# 这里假设我们以亮度为标准创建一个掩码
# 对于灰度值低于128的区域,我们将其视为前景
gray = cv2.c
```
0
0